IperfPseudoCode

NOTE: This pseudo-code is fairly old, and dates back to 2009. iperf follows roughly the same general workflow as in this document, however there have been some changes and additions (such as the addition of server mode and SCTP functionality).

def main(): test = iperf_new_test(); iperf_set_defaults(test); process arguments this will populate parts of test and test->default_settings switch protocol case TCP: testp->create_stream = tcp_new_stream testp->accept = tcp_accept case UDP: testp->create_stream = udp_new_stream testp->accept = udp_accept if client: foreach stream: sp = testp->new_stream() iperf_init_streams() iperf_run() def tcp_new_stream(testp): sp = iperf_new_stream(testp) sp->recv = tcp_recv sp->send = tcp_send sp->init = tcp_init sp->update_stats = tcp_update_stats return sp def udp_new_stream(testp): sp = iperf_new_stream(testp) sp->recv = udp_recv sp->send = udp_send sp->init = udp_init sp->update_stats = udp_update_stats return sp def tcp_recv(sp): recv(sp->socket) update stats def tcp_send(sp): send(sp->socket) update stats def tcp_init(sp): populate sp->local_addr & sp->remote_addr set_window_size, etc set other socket options, etc allocate a packet buffer zero out stats def udp_recv(sp): recv(sp->socket) update stats def udp_send(sp): calculate if it's time to send based on rate send(sp->socket) update stats def udp_init(sp): populate sp->local_addr & sp->remote_addr set socket options, etc allocate a packet buffer zero out stats def udp_accept(testp): sp = udp_new_stream() sp->socket = *socket test->lisener_sock = listen() iperf_add_stream(testp, sp) def tcp_accept(testp): sp = tcp_new_stream() sp->socket = accept(testp->listener_sock) iperf_add_stream(testp, sp) def iperf_run(testp): switch (testp->role) case server: iperf_run_server() case client: iperf_run_client() def iperf_run_server(testp): while not done: select() if new_stream: test->accept() if stream_end_message_received: shutdown stream if test_end_message_received: break if results_request_message_received: send_results() process each readable socket free resources def iperf_run_client(struct iperf_test *testp) while time_left: select() process each writable socket call stats_callback if it's time call reporter_callback if it's time for each stream send shutdown message send remote stats request print local and remote stats free resources
